John D. Day was born in 1798 in Anne Arundel County, Maryland.[1]
Name appears most often as John D. Day. However, Cemetery Marker is for John Decatur Day, Jr, which suggests his full name would be John Decatur Day (Sr.)
John D. Day was born in Maryland in 1798. [2]
On 21 October 1830 in Anne Arundel County, Maryland, he married Matilda Hobbs born 1791.[1]
On 21 Oct 1830 in Baltimore MD he married Matilda Burgess, b. abt 1798, d. MD. aft 1870. [2]
In 1830 he was in District 5, Anne Arundel County, Maryland.[1]
In 1840 he was in Division 3, Anne Arundel County, Maryland[1]
In 1850 he was in part of Anne Arundel County, Maryland.[1]
1850 Census Farmer. [2]
In 1860 he was in the 5th District, Howard County, Maryland[1]
In 1870 he was in District 5, Howard County, Maryland [1]
In 1870 Census in Maryland he was in District 5 (Howard), Savage P.O., living with his son Marcellus and family. In the 1870 Census in Maryland she was living with her son John D. and his family. [3]
He died after 1870 in Maryland [2]
John D. Day died in 1872 in Maryland, United States. [1]
